Planning appeal decision
Sackville Street, opposite no.60, Manchester, M1 3BU
the proposed removal of an existing InLink Unit, and the deployment of a replacement Street Hub 3 unit

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- Appeal A: the effect of the proposed development on the character and appearance of the area with particular regard to whether it would preserve or enhance the character or appearance of the Whitworth Street Conservation Area and the setting of a nearby listed building and non-designated heritage asset
- Appeal B: the effect of the proposed advertisement on the visual amenity of the area
What decided it
The existing InLink unit with illuminated digital display already forms part of the established character of the area, and the replacement would not be so materially different in siting, scale, form and function as to cause unacceptable harm to heritage assets or visual amenity when appropriate conditions are imposed.
